Handy information about Cape Town Airport (CPT)
Cape Town Airport has an excellent on-time performance, reducing your chances of a delayed flight. Departures from CPT arrive at their destination as scheduled 81% of the time.
Cape Town Airport is around 19 kilometres from central Cape Town. If you're driving, ride-sharing or catching a taxi from the centre, it'll take 25 minutes or so to get there, depending on the traffic.
Planning to catch public transport? Expect a journey time of around 35 minutes.

Getting from Lisbon Airport (LIS) to central Lisbon
Lisbon Airport to central Lisbon has a drive time of around 20 minutes. It's approximately 8 kilometres away.
It takes around 25 minutes if you're using public transport.
When to fly to Lisbon Airport (LIS)
The quietest month for a flight from Cape Town Airport to Lisbon Airport is March, while August is the busiest. Pick the ideal time to visit Lisbon based on whether you prefer a faster pace or a more relaxed vibe.
The warmest month in Lisbon is August, with the temperature ranging between 16ºC (61ºF) and 29ºC (84ºF). Lock in your flights from Cape Town Airport to Lisbon Airport in this month if this is the type of weather you like.
Look for cheap tickets from CPT to LIS in January if you want to travel in cooler conditions. Temperatures are at their lowest then, ranging between 8ºC (46ºF) and 16ºC (61ºF) on average.
